@swr-login/plugin-password
v0.2.1
Published
Username/password login plugin for swr-login
Maintainers
Readme
@swr-login/plugin-password
Username/password login plugin for swr-login.
Install
npm install @swr-login/plugin-passwordUsage
import { PasswordPlugin } from '@swr-login/plugin-password';
const plugin = PasswordPlugin({
loginUrl: '/api/login',
});Then use the useLogin hook:
const { login, isLoading, error } = useLogin('password');
await login({ username: 'alice', password: 'secret' });Options
| Option | Type | Required | Description |
|--------|------|----------|-------------|
| loginUrl | string | ✅ | Your backend login endpoint |
Part of swr-login
See the full project at github.com/tobytovi/swr-login.
